Plaster Relief Sculpture

Cast out of gypsum cement into a variety of ubiquitous materials, these plaster relief sculptures straddle the line between precision fabrication and the adoption of Wabi-Sabi, a traditional Japanese aesthetic that embraces the transient and imperfect. Each sculpture mold is individually hand-crafted by manipulating the materials to achieve the desired composition. After being removed from the mold, each piece is sealed and features an embedded mounting system.
